Ahh, I'm with you now, @meaningfull!
That is correct, you won't be able to edit or rename the images from this folder directly. You have the option to name the file when uploading the image for the first time (you would do this from your desktop folder).
Other than that, editing the images within the Site Editor folder would be a feature request at this time.
You certainly raise a good point with there being no option to add alt text to the image used within the Main Banner section. I'll go ahead and pass this directly on to our Product Team for consideration. I can't guarantee an ETA on this change but we'll at least get the ball rolling here.
